BELAGAVI: Three labourers died on the spot after an oil-filled tanker ran over them while they were engaged in road construction on the Pune-Bengaluru four-lane NH near Itagi Cross in Kittur taluk Sunday.
The deceased were Ramanna, Mahesh, and Ramachandra, all of Kalaburagi.
Three other workers, who were injured, were taken to the hospital. A case was registered. The tanker that ran over the workers overturned on the service road.
Condition of the driver is also critical.
